  15. Good info, everyone should be cognizant of this. In my early 20's I was dumb and failed to pay on my student loans for a while, that along with some medical bills sunk my score to the mid-low 500s. I used "WhyChat Credit Confusion" site to eliminate the medical collections. I consolidated and squared my student loan payments. For the most part, I became a credit abiding member of society. Within 4 years I was in the mid-600s and bought a house and a car. Now, I am in the mid-high 700s and can get approved for most anything. My most recent gains have been from increasing my revolving credit lines (over 200k) with at or near 0% utilization. I've gained about 30 points despite the hard pulls. \ With minimal work and attention most anyone living within their means should be able to do this, the benefits go far beyond the minimal amount of work to get there.
